1. The Paradigm Shift: ICAR is now CUET (UG)
The most important thing you must know is that the traditional ICAR AIEEA (UG) exam has been scrapped. Admissions to 20% of the All-India Quota seats in Agricultural Universities (like TNAU in Tamil Nadu, IARI in Delhi) are now conducted exclusively through the Common University Entrance Test (CUET UG).
When you fill out the CUET application, you must select the correct "Domain Subjects." If you are a biology student, your combination should ideally be Physics, Chemistry, and Biology (PCB) or Physics, Chemistry, and Agriculture (PCA). You must check the specific eligibility criteria of the university you are targeting.
2. The Massive Advantage: Class 12 Syllabus Only
Here is why ICAR via CUET is significantly easier to crack than NEET or JEE: The exam strictly tests the Class 12th NCERT Syllabus.
"Unlike NEET, which requires you to memorize the massive Class 11 syllabus, CUET strictly restricts its domain subject questions to Class 12."
If you have just finished your 12th Board exams, your Class 12 concepts are already fresh. You do not need to spend six months revising 11th standard Mechanics or Plant Physiology. You just need to convert your subjective board-exam knowledge into objective MCQ-solving speed.
3. Subject-Wise Strategy for PCB/PCA
Biology: The Rank Decider
Since the syllabus is restricted to Class 12, the examiner will go exceptionally deep into Genetics, Evolution, Biotechnology, and Ecology. You must memorize every single line, scientist name, and diagram label from the Class 12 NCERT Biology textbook. Do not use complex coaching materials; NCERT is the absolute gold standard here.
Agriculture (If Opted)
If you choose Agriculture instead of Biology as your domain subject, you have a massive scoring advantage. The syllabus covers Agrometeorology, Genetics, Plant Breeding, Crop Production, and Horticulture. Standard ICAR-approved introductory books (like Nem Raj Sunda) are perfect for MCQs. The questions are highly factual and take less than 15 seconds to answer.
Physics & Chemistry
The physics in CUET is less brutal than JEE, but it heavily tests calculation speed and direct formula application. In Chemistry, focus aggressively on Class 12 Organic Chemistry (Name Reactions, Polymers, Biomolecules) and the P, D, and F block elements from Inorganic Chemistry.
4. The "CBT" Reality Check
CUET is a 100% Computer Based Test (CBT). If you are a NEET student, you are used to solving questions on a physical paper with a pen.
Solving a complex pedigree chart in Biology or a Physics numerical while staring at a glaring computer screen is a completely different ballgame. If you do not practice online mock tests, your eyes will fatigue within 45 minutes, and your accuracy will collapse. You must mandate taking at least 20 full-length CBT mock tests on a desktop computer before exam day.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Can PCM (Maths) students apply for B.Sc Agriculture through ICAR?
Yes, absolutely! PCM students are eligible for B.Sc Agriculture, B.Tech (Agricultural Engineering), and B.Tech (Dairy Technology). You must choose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ics as your domain subjects in CUET.
2. Is there negative marking in the exam?
Yes. In the CUET UG format, every correct answer gives you +5 marks, and every incorrect answer gives you -1 mark (negative marking). Unattempted questions yield 0 marks. Blind guessing will destroy your percentile.
